Top Options for Bathroom Flooring
Thursday, 04 May 2023 / Published in Flooring Advice, Laminate Flooring

Top Options for Bathroom Flooring

These are Cherry Carpets Top Options for Bathroom Flooring. When you are choosing bathroom flooring, the first thing that you should look at is durability and resistance to wear and tear. The flooring material should feel good under bare foot because there are many who prefer to use the bathroom without slippers. Another main consideration is how the floor material will react to moisture. Taking into account all these factors, here we bring to you some of the best options for bathroom floors.

Top Options for Bathroom Flooring

Stone

Stone flooring has a lot of options including limestone, granite, marble and others. The best thing about stone is that you do not have to face any problems with moisture. However, you need to maintain it properly and be very careful while using it since stone often tends to be slippery. This problem can be resolved by texturing the stone surface through sandblasting. The cost is a bit on the higher side, but if you can afford it, it is really a great choice.

Ceramic Tile

Although it is fairly expensive, this material comes with a lot of positive qualities such as beautiful appearance, rich texture, solid build and waterproof nature.  Ceramic tiles are available in a range of shapes and sizes, making room for considerable amount of creativity, if you wish so.

Sheet or Tile Vinyl

Vinyl is one of the most popular choices when it comes to bathroom flooring, primarily because the tiles can be easily installed, and a large number of varieties are available, the two commonest being sheet and tile. Tile is easier to install than sheet while the latter is more durable. Moreover, vinyl is quite affordable due to its low price.

Not So Top Options for Bathroom Flooring

Laminate Flooring

It is very easy to clean this flooring material.  It has a wood chip base, which has the possibility to come in contact with moisture. If you take proper precautions to protect this wood base from moisture, the material works well for bathrooms. With laminate, you have a wide range of choices such as pine, oak, travertine, Tuscan stone, slate, and the like. With laminate their is always the risk of the moisture affecting and ruining your new floor.

Solid Hardwood

Solid hardwood renders a great look and with it, you can feel warm under the feet. Moisture and hardwood does not gel well with each other. If you are thinking of going for solid hardwood, make sure you don’t get to much water on your wood flooring for moisture to seep in. It is advisable to always wipe excess moisture off the surface. With wood their is always the risk of the moisture affecting and ruining your new floor.
